Meet Mary Kate

Born: 2001

Diagnosis: Spinal muscular atrophy (SMA)

Services used: Respiratory, infusion nursing and pharmacy

Mary Kate's Challenge

CHALLENGE

Born with the most damaging type of spinal muscular atrophy – type I – Mary Kate isn’t strong enough to walk, sit up by herself, or most importantly, clear her own airway. She cannot cough on her own, so normal secretions from her lungs block her ability to breathe.

Solution

PHS respiratory therapists team up with her family to ensure they have the support necessary to maintain airway clearance and help her stay healthy at home, where she is safest. PHS provided numerous therapies and technologies, such as interpulmonary percussive ventilation, which ‘shakes’ Mary Kate’s lungs clear.

Mary Kate's Solution

Results

Mary Kate wasn’t expected to live past two; she’s now a teenager and living at home.
